From http://www.jenasix.org/ :

 

17-year-old Robert Bailey Junior -bail was set at $138,000

17-year-old Theo Shaw - bail was set at $130,000

18-year-old Carwin Jones - bail was set at $100,000

17-year-old Bryant Purvis - bail was set at $70,000

16 year old Mychal Bell - bail was set at $90,000

 

 

Mychal Bell remained in jail from December 2006 until his trial because his family was unable to post the $90,000 bond. Theo Shaw has also remained in jail. Several of the other defendants remained in jail for months until their families could raise the money for bond.

Here's a little something off that jenasix site . . . .

" Friday night, December 1st, a black student was beaten by a group of white students at a "white party".

 

Saturday, December 2nd, at the Gotta Go convenience store, the black student who was beaten up the night before, along with his friends, ran into one of the white students who beat him. A confrontation broke out and the white student went to his vehicle to get his shotgun. The black students wrestled the shotgun away from him and brought it to the police department and told them of the incident. The black students were arrested for stealing the gun. The white student was not charged."
